## v2.8.0 — Changed defaults

Heads up, plugin folks: we've tweaked the default warm-pool settings for Quenchly serverless handlers. Cold starts were biting anyone with bursty traffic, so handlers now keep a small warm reserve by default. If your plugin spawns its own handlers, you'll inherit these. The new default configuration values are shown below.

config for yawep-tajef:
[kelion]
team = kelys
access_code = ac_1a130d
owner = holax.aldmir
host = kelion.urlaqforge.example
port = 9090
peer = fenmir.lumicio.example
salt = d0dd3cb5
pin = 3295

**Management Meeting Minutes — Harwick Tooling**

Quick recap for branch managers: warranty costs on the Veltra grinder line ran 18% over budget last quarter, mostly motor housing failures. Dena Okafor's team is chasing the supplier in Brandelow for rework credits. Claims handling stays unchanged for now. Please flag any unusual return patterns early. Details on next steps below.

internal memo for kawip-hadug: Headcount on the Wenwyn team goes from 7 to 140 by the end of January. Gross margin on Wenwyn came in at 20 percent against a plan of 15 percent.

Vendor note: Brightmark Retail contracts Pellwood Systems to maintain the Astercrest loyalty-points ledger. As a new contractor, please review the reconciliation schedule before making any changes; ledger adjustments require sign-off from the vendor liaison and must be logged in the Astercrest change register within one business day. For onboarding questions or access requests, reach the vendor desk at the address below.

escalation mailbox, yajeg-bageg: quenax.olidor@lumiccorp.internal